Replacement of the Battery

When you are replacing bmw key the battery on your BMW key fob There are a few important things to remember. The first is to make sure you are purchasing the right battery for your needs. with the key fob you have. A quick online search can help you find the right fit. After that, you should make sure that you have the correct tools to accomplish the task. Typically, you'll require the smallest screwdriver or coin to pry open the key fob. Also, remember to apply gentle pressure when you install the new battery. This will avoid any damage to internal components or the key fob.

It should take just a few moments to change the battery on your bmw spare key key fob. First, you'll need remove the blade made of metal from the key fob. Then, you'll need to use a tiny tool like a coin or screwdriver to pry open the BMW key fob. After removing the battery you'll have to replace it with an CR2032.

After you have inserted the battery, you will need to shut both halves of the fob. You can do this by pressing a button located on the back of the key fob. Once the two halves have been closed, you will hear a snapping sound that indicates that they are securely joined.

Transponder Chip Replacement

BMW keys are equipped with a special security microchip that communicates with the computer system in the car to ensure that the key fob has been properly paired before the engine can start. These chips help protect against theft and are extremely difficult to replace without the assistance of an experienced locksmith.

If your key is lost or Key replacement bmw stolen an expert locksmith can reprogram it to work with the security systems of your vehicle. This is less expensive than going to a dealer and can be done faster.

You can buy an alternative BMW Key online, but it will need to be programmed by a locksmith or dealer prior to it can work with your vehicle. Locksmiths are equipped with the tools and expertise to synchronize the electronic components of the fob and the key with your car's system, but it's crucial to consult with the locksmith prior to time to ensure that they can handle your specific make and model.
